1
0
mirror of https://github.com/woodpecker-ci/woodpecker.git synced 2024-12-06 08:16:19 +02:00
Woodpecker is a simple yet powerful CI/CD engine with great extensibility.
Go to file
Brad Rydzewski 23234fa000 Merge pull request #1778 from strk/gogs-pr-hook
Add sample gogs web hooks (unused yet) [CI SKIP]
2016-09-01 15:51:56 -05:00
.github refact yaml operations to yaml package 2016-04-19 13:02:28 -07:00
agent Merge pull request #1771 from bradrydzewski/master 2016-08-30 10:02:19 -07:00
build Adding the ability to label containers that are launched using 2016-08-13 14:38:37 -07:00
bus fully functioning build using 0.5 agents 2016-04-21 00:25:30 -07:00
cache replace UI with single page application (#1704) 2016-07-08 15:40:29 -07:00
client Fix URI encoding 2016-08-19 18:27:08 +01:00
drone Merge pull request #1762 from appleboy/patch-6 [CI SKIP] 2016-08-30 20:30:55 -07:00
model Separated repo and team secret models 2016-07-31 23:25:10 +02:00
queue fix a typo in queue.go 2016-05-11 18:53:48 +08:00
remote Merge pull request #1778 from strk/gogs-pr-hook 2016-09-01 15:51:56 -05:00
router Copied MustAdmin into MustTeamAdmin for now 2016-08-01 23:58:13 +02:00
server Fix a typo in reserved build params 2016-08-11 21:57:38 +03:00
shared refactoring github package to increase test coverage 2016-05-02 17:47:58 -07:00
store Moved merged secret list into store 2016-08-01 23:03:31 +02:00
stream added code to manage secrets 2016-04-23 04:27:28 -07:00
vendor updated vendored deps 2016-05-23 14:41:01 -07:00
version bump version number, auto-pull new plugins, process http_proxy vars 2016-05-12 22:14:33 -07:00
yaml Merge branch 'master' into add-container-labels 2016-08-30 18:44:33 -04:00
.dockerignore update yaml for s3 upload 2016-05-26 11:08:48 -07:00
.drone.yml replace UI with single page application (#1704) 2016-07-08 15:40:29 -07:00
.drone.yml.sig replace UI with single page application (#1704) 2016-07-08 15:40:29 -07:00
.gitignore replace UI with single page application (#1704) 2016-07-08 15:40:29 -07:00
Dockerfile fix go coding style by gofmt. 2016-08-14 12:25:45 +08:00
Dockerfile.arm64 update yaml for s3 upload 2016-05-26 11:08:48 -07:00
Dockerfile.armhf update yaml for s3 upload 2016-05-26 11:08:48 -07:00
Dockerfile.windows update yaml for s3 upload 2016-05-26 11:08:48 -07:00
LICENSE initial public commit 2014-02-07 03:10:01 -07:00
MAINTAINERS Update MAINTAINERS [CI SKIP] 2015-12-09 14:12:55 -08:00
Makefile Speedup local build iterations by reusing built packages 2016-09-01 17:45:08 +01:00
README.md remove outdated links to sassc [CI SKIP] 2016-07-21 17:02:59 -07:00

Build Status Release Status Gitter

Drone is a Continuous Integration platform built on container technology. Every build is executed inside an ephemeral Docker container, giving developers complete control over their build environment with guaranteed isolation.

Goals

Drone's prime directive is to help teams ship code like GitHub. Drone is easy to install, setup and maintain and offers a powerful container-based plugin system. Drone aspires to be an industry-wide replacement for Jenkins.

Documentation

Drone documentation is organized into several categories:

Documentation for 0.5 (unstable)

If you are using the 0.5 unstable release (master branch) please see the updated documentation:

Community, Help

Contributions, questions, and comments are welcomed and encouraged. Drone developers hang out in the drone/drone room on gitter. We ask that you please post your questions to gitter before creating an issue.

Installation

Please see our installation guide to install the official Docker image.

From Source

Clone the repository to your Go workspace:

git clone git://github.com/drone/drone.git $GOPATH/src/github.com/drone/drone
cd $GOPATH/src/github.com/drone/drone

Commands to build from source:

export GO15VENDOREXPERIMENT=1

make deps    # Download required dependencies
make gen     # Generate code
make build   # Build the binary

If you are having trouble building this project please reference its .drone.yml file. Everything you need to know about building Drone is defined in that file.